Hilltop Ruapehu is nestled on six private & secluded acres, yet minutes from cafes & shops of NZ's friendliest rural town.

The Lodge at Hilltop sleeps 6, is very comfortably furnished and set in its own grounds. Quality bedding & towels - nothing is spared to make your stay truely memorable.
Persian rugs and works of art from The Hilltop Collection make for cosy and original surroundings.
Large terrace.

The Cottage at Hilltop sleeps 2 is fully self contained with large enclosed terrace with unsurpassed rural views.

You may book both The Lodge and The Cottage for exclusive use of the retreat Sleeps 8- enjoy as your own.

Hilltop is an ideal touring base - Mt Ruapehu, The Forgotten World Highway, Lake Taupo, Waitomo Caves, Tongariro National Park (Tongariro Crossing) and Whanganui National Park are within easy driving distance.

Because the cottage was marketed like boutique accommodation we were surprised to find it was just an old garage sleepout with grass growing out filthy gutters. The lawns hadn't been mowed for a long time and everything was overgrown. The "cottage" itself needed a really good clean (especially floors) and the bed smelled of damp and mold which was gross. The bathroom (which has a curtain as a door) has no fan to get rid of moisture or smells so it all ends up in the bedroom. The toilet didn't really flush properly. The water is so strongly chlorinated that we had to buy our own. There is a lovely view off the back veranda but everything is covered in cobwebs and dirt, and the table was smeared with something. The broken front door glass is patched with sellotape. When we removed the bin liner we found a lot of mold and smell. All this is fine for a cheap and cheerful low-end bach, cleaned by the occupants, but not something marketed as "hilltop ruapehu". Not worth the 3 hour drive.
